Beam Analysis Program is a structural engineering software used for beam analysis and design. It can perform calculations for beam reactions, shear force, bending moment, deflection, and stress checks per building codes.
EngiLab Beam.2D is a structural analysis and design software for beams, frames and trusses in 2D. It allows for analysis, optimization and code checking based on various international design standards.
